Study Summary

The study will evaluate the safety and early efficacy of administering the combination of a commercially available potato-based resistant starch along with iron chelation therapy to subjects undergoing alloHCT.

Primary Outcome

Assessed in a time-to-event analysis, with GRFS defined as the first occurrence of grade III or IV acute GVHD, chronic GVHD warranting systemic immunosuppression, disease relapse or progression, or death from any cause.

Interventions

  • DRUG Iron chelation
  • DRUG Potato Resistant Starch
